Thursday, July 28, 2011

Sun Ra on Detroit TV, 1981

Sun Ra on Detroit TV, 1981: "

Broadcast on Detroit local television in 1981, this interview with Sun Ra reminds us of what we already knew: he was a brilliant, uncompromising, truth-talking visionary.

The mother of all mother ships.


No comments:

Post a Comment